Overview Lefra 20 Tablet

Rheumacin 20mg tablets treat rheumatoid and psoriatic arthritis, slowing disease progression and alleviating pain, inflammation, and redness. Administer with or without food, consistently at the same time daily for optimal results. Continue as prescribed, completing the course even with symptom improvement. Common side effects include nausea, headache, indigestion, skin rash, diarrhea, and elevated liver enzymes. Report persistent or worsening side effects to your physician, who can advise on managing them.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or of any heart, kidney, or liver conditions, and all other medications. Regular blood tests may be recommended to monitor liver function and blood cell counts.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should seek medical advice before use.

How to use Lefra 20 Tablet:

Administer this medication precisely as prescribed by your physician, respecting both dosage and treatment length. Ingest the t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or fracturing it. Lefra 20 Tablet can be consumed with or without food, though consistent timing is recommended.

How Lefra 20 Tablet works:

Lefra 20 Tablets inhibit specific inflammatory mediators, thus reducing the swelling, redness, and inflammation characteristic of some autoimmune disorders. The medication addresses the root cause of the disease, not merely its symptoms.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Avoid alcohol while taking Lefra 20 Tablet.

PregnancyPregnancyUNSAFE

Using Lefra 20 Tablet during pregnancy poses a substantial risk. Pregnant women should consult their physician; research in animals and pregnant humans indicates considerable harm to the fetus.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Lefra 20 Tablet while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available data from humans indicate a potential for the medication to trans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ving should be avoided if you experience drowsiness, blurred vision, dizziness, or reduced alertness after taking Lefra 20 Tablet, as these are possible side effects.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ney impairment should exercise caution when using Lefra 20 T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verUNSAFE

Individuals with liver conditions should likely abstain from Lefra 20 Tablet due to potential safety concerns. Medical advice is recommended.

What if you forget to take Lefra 20 Tablet :

Should you forget a Lefra 20 Tablet dose,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Lefra 20 Tablet

Lefra 20 Tablet can sometimes cause weight loss, though typically this is minimal. Reduced appetite may be the cause. Seek medical advice if you experience substantial weight loss.
Inform your doctor immediately if you experience lung issues such as cough or shortness of breath; infectious symptoms like fever, weakness, or flu; allergic reactions including hives or rashes; liver problems such as jaundice or appetite loss; a decreased blood cell count resulting in easy bruising or frequent infections; or if you become pregnant during treatment.
Lefra 20 Tablet remains in your system for an extended period. Therefore, avoid pregnancy for at least two years after discontinuing its use. However, specific medications may shorten this time to a few weeks by accelerating Lefra 20 Tablet's elimination.
Significant improvement from Lefra 20 Tablet may take 4 weeks or more, with full benefits potentially taking 4-6 months. Do not discontinue use if you don't see immediate results. Consult your doctor for any questions.
Lefra 20 Tablet may rarely increase the risk of cancer, particularly lymphomas, possibly due to immune system weakening. Consult your doctor if you have concerns.
